Cleaning UPVC windows

When cleaning UPVC windows, you have make sure you use the right tools to ensure you get an excellent result. If you use the wrong cleaning products this could cause irreparable damage to your windows. These tips can assist you in avoiding this.

A vacuum cleaner fitted with a soft brush attachment can be used to clean your uPVC windows frames. This will eliminate dust and dirt that may have built up on the hinges. It is also recommended to clean the inside of your uPVC window panes using a non-smear window cleaner.

To clean your uPVC window frames Soft, lint free white towels are ideal. These should be changed whenever they start to get dirty.

A microfibre cloth can be an option. These cloths are gentle, scratch-proof, and help restore the shine of your uPVC.

You may have to use a cream cleaner in the event that your uPVC windows have a discoloration. Apply the solution to only a small area, and allow it to soak for a couple of minutes. After this process is completed you can wipe the area with a dry, clean cloth.

A mixture of water and vinegar can also be utilized. Apply it on the spot and allow it to sit for ten minutes. This will help to break up dirt and other debris and make it easier to scrub. After a few minutes, clean your windows and wipe them clean using an air-tight, dry rag.

Cleaning your uPVC windows should never be accomplished using pads that are abrasive. They can damage your uPVC's glossy finish. You could also permanently ruin the shine of your upvc windows repair near me windows if you try and clean a stain by using an Abrasive cleaner.
